Attaining overall elimination needs a deep understanding of pest biology rather than indiscriminate chemical distribution. Experienced professionals start the procedure with a meticulous structural evaluation to draw up active feeding paths and identify the particular species included. Managing a population of extremely reproductive German cockroaches inside a pantry demands an entirely different approach to obstructing bigger American or Oriental cockroaches wandering up from external subfloor drain lines. Professionals use specialized optical gear, thermal sensing units, and sticky monitoring pads to trace nocturnal motions, ensuring that remediation efforts are released exactly where the pests gather.

The real danger of letting an infestation spread unchecked website is the serious health hazard it poses to the home. Cockroaches are opportunistic scavengers that frequently stroll through greatly infected areas such as outside grease traps, garbage storage zones, and compost heap. While checking out these areas, they get harmful microscopic pathogens and germs on their legs and exoskeletons. When they traverse kitchen counters, exposed meals, and food‑preparation surface areas, they deposit dangerous traces that can cause serious stomach ailments and food poisoning. In addition, the buildup of shed skins, tiny saliva droplets, and droppings can break down into great airborne dust, a major reason for chronic breathing problems and serious allergic reactions in children.

Modern pest control highlights baiting techniques that exploit bugs' inherent social habits. Rather than utilizing aggressive, broad‑spectrum aerosol sprays that merely give a short‑lived knock‑down, experts inconspicuously position advanced, ultra‑attractive gel baits inside hidden cracks and crevices. These baits are created to act gradually, giving the foraging cockroach time to consume the poison and retreat safely to its deep nest before it takes effect. Because cockroaches repeatedly take in dead nestmates, the toxin quickly shares throughout the hidden colony. This secondary poisoning triggers a powerful domino effect that systematically eliminates the colony's reproductive heart.

Long term success depends heavily on the continuous practices of the residential or commercial property locals. Depriving a nest of its main food supply is an exceptionally powerful preventative procedure. Easy modifications, such as sweeping away loose crumbs beneath big kitchen home appliances, wiping down food preparation areas before bed, and storing all dry goods in sturdy, airtight plastic containers, will immediately stall a colony development. Guaranteeing that domestic rubbish bins feature tight fitting lids and removing kept cardboard boxes from garage floorings also gets rid of the dark, tight nesting environments where these nighttime creatures feel most safe and secure during daytime hours.

Keeping indoor humidity under control is just as vital for maintaining a pest‑free home. While cockroaches can withstand long stretches without solid food, they need a constant water system to make it through. Inspect the plumbing below sinks for small leaks, ensure bathroom exhaust fans thoroughly dry wet locations after showers, and fix any dripping faucet in the laundry to quickly render the interior unwelcoming. House owners can likewise commit a weekend to scrutinize exterior brickwork, using high‑quality versatile sealant to seal gaps around utility pipeline entries and window frames, therefore blocking possible entry points for future invaders.
